I'm working on replacing the repeater receiver on my 902 ham system, and like a lot of you I'm looking to use a converted Maxtrac.
I have read from a lot of you that you're achieving "excellent" receive sensitivity, however, I haven't seen actual numbers. The one I have in front of me now has been modified for the VCO switching, 915 filters installed, and programmed up for my repeater input of 902.7125.. The best I'm seeing here is around .5uv for 12db sinad.. I consider that far from excellent. My present repeater receiver is a Hamtronics crystal strip, and I'm nabbing well over .2uv on it.. The Hamtronics however, has a rather poor front end and my site is a noisy site. The Maxtrac would no doubt be more selective and cleaner, but I would like to get a bit more out of this than .5uv if you know what I mean!
